This week, we will continue our ocean animal theme. The students will be sequencing fiction and non fiction stories, writing their own story and reading sentences with trick words. They will learn a new trick word: one. They will be practicing math facts, writing numbers and solving number stories this week as well. In science, the students will be learning a little bit about sea turtles (especially the Loggerhead Turtle) and the life cycle of a turtle.
